Recommended Storing Locations (on some models)
For best storing and serving temperatures for your bottle of wine, 
use the wine producer's recommended temperature setting. See 
the wine’s label for details. It is recommended to store wine for 
short-term (few months) at 55°F (13°C).
Wine Racks
Remove and Replace the Top and Middle Racks
To Remove Racks:
1. Pull the rack forward until it stops. 
2. Lift up on both sides of the rack to clear the shelf brackets 
from the bracket support pins. 
3. Pull the rack forward and out of the rack supports.
To Replace Racks:
1. Insert the rack into the compartment and slide it toward 
the rear of the wine cellar.
2. Align the bracket support pins with the holes in the shelf 
brackets, and then place the shelf into the rack supports 
until properly in place.
Stocking the Wine Cellar
NOTE: For optimum wine storage, place white wines at the top of 
the wine cellar, light red wines in the center and red wines at the 
bottom.
To Stock the Wine Cellar
1. Start stocking the wine cellar with the bottom display rack.
2. Starting on the left-hand side, place the first bottle in the rack 
on its side with the neck of the bottle facing the front of the 
wine cellar.
3. Place the next bottle on its side with the neck of the bottle 
facing the back of the wine cellar.
4. Alternate in this manner until the display rack is full.
5. Push the rack all the way in before pulling the next one 
forward.
6. Pull the next rack forward and repeat steps 2 through 4; 
repeat for remaining racks.
